I had to code a solver before I could come up with a generator for my Sudoku Game.

Luckily there are plenty of resources for algorithms etc.

If you choose an Advanced puzzle you can watch it generating the puzzle. It tries solving it each time it adds a number - if it CAN solve it, then it gives you the puzzle.

In "Advanced Hard" mode, it actually removes clues until there is only ONE solution.
